  3. Hace 5 días · The DSM-5 outlines specific criteria that must be met for a diagnosis of catatonia. These criteria include the presence of at least three or more of the following symptoms: stupor, catalepsy, waxy flexibility, mutism, negativism, posturing, mannerisms, stereotypies, grimacing, echolalia, or echopraxia.

Hace 5 días · In patients who meet diagnostic criteria for catatonia and have a positive response to a lorazepam challenge, initiation of scheduled benzodiazepines is the first-line treatment, with dose and duration of treatment titrated to sustained resolution of symptoms. 6 The response rate to benzodiazepines is approximately 65%, independent of ...
